The ED White Commanders will face off against the Riverside Generals at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. Having both just faced considerable losses, both teams are looking to turn things around.
ED White came up short against Eagle's View on Tuesday, falling 32-20. The Commanders haven't had much luck with the Warriors recently, as the team has come up short the last five times they've met.
Janari Buessey led a balanced group of hitters, getting on base in all five of her plate appearances with five runs. Melly Rivera Cruz was another key player, getting on base in four of her five plate appearances with four runs, one stolen base, and two RBI.
Meanwhile, Riverside lost 15-1 to Orange Park on Wednesday.
Riverside saw three different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was N Ashberry, who went 1-for-2 with two stolen bases and one run.
ED White's defeat dropped their record down to 4-6. As for Riverside, their loss dropped their record down to 6-12.
Thursday's game might come down to which pitcher can control the ball better. ED White has hit smart this season, having averaged an OBP of .629. However, it's not like Riverside struggles in that department as they've averaged .500. With both teams so capable at the plate, fans should be ready for an impressive hitting performance.
ED White suffered a grim 24-8 defeat to Riverside when the teams last played back in February. Will the Commanders have more luck at home instead of on the road? Check back here after the action for a full breakdown and analysis of the contest.
